WebBirmingham, in the West Midlands, is Britain's second-largest city. Known in the Victorian era as the "City of a Thousand Trades" and the "Workshop of the World", Brum, as locals call the city, is enjoying a 21st-century resurgence as a great shopping and cultural destination. The Birmingham Back to Backs are one of the must unique attractions to the city. Situated near the Arcadian, this 19th-century courtyard of working-people’s houses was painstakingly restored by the National Trust to offer an atmospheric and educational experience to visitors.

WebThe climate of Birmingham is oceanic, with quite cold, rainy winters and mild, relatively rainy summers. The city is located in west-central England, in the West Midlands, at an altitude of 140 meters (460 feet). Winter is not …
